From what I'm reading is there may be mounting issues with the large ocular bell and magnification adjuster ring. Have any of you used one on a savage short action?

I've got one, but it's not mounted yet, it's going on my 10/22 with a Volquartsen cantilever rail. I haven't tried it on a Savage, but I might be able help. The ring is large, about 1.7" in diameter, but the biggest issue I've seen so far with it is the long eye relief, It's got to be mounted farther forward than normal, that's why I picked up the cantilever rail.

I can tell you that if you want to mount it with the power ring low and behind the rail, the rings need a space of at least .19" between the tube and the rail, and the rail needs to be no longer than 6", the Weaver short action rail will work, my EGW with the extension over the barrel nut will not. However this may put the scope too far back considering the long eye relief.

Instead, I would use the lowest rail you can find and use rings that will put the power ring above the rail so you can move it forward. For that you will need at least .35" gap between the tube and the rail. I'd use the 1" Burris Signature Zee High rings. they will leave about .05" between the rail and the power ring.
